配方
配方基于在配方模式对象中定义的成分。
使用配方编辑器小组件,可以在运行时管理配方,或者开发自己的配方解决方案。
配方模式
使用配方模式对象可以定义用于创建配方的变量集。配方用于定义与架构中的变量相对应的值。
小贴士:
您可以基于单个配方模式对象创建多个配方,这对于还原先前的配方设置很有用。
配方模式成分
在设计时,通过设置配方模式对象的
目标节点
属性来定义配方模式成分。目标节点可以是包含所需变量的任何项目节点。
例如,目标节点可以是:
- 模型文件夹
- 模型文件夹内的对象
- 包含一个或多个控制器中变量的节点
小贴士:
在复杂项目中,要将包含在多个节点中的变量定义为配方模式的成分,请在
模型
文件夹中创建一个专用对象,并在其内部添加变量。然后,在变量和成分之间创建动态链接。如果将对象选作目标节点,则可以直观地选择配方模式的成分,因为只有对象中引用的变量才显示出来。编辑模型节点
如果要开发自己的配方管理工具,有必要了解如何编辑模型节点。
当用户在运行时从数据库创建、编辑或加载配方时,将自动在根项目节点中创建
编辑模型
节点的别名。别名节点与它引用的配方模式同名。在保存节点、删除节点或将节点发送到控制器之前,节点将包含已创建、已编辑或已加载的配方数据的临时副本。可以在设计时引用
编辑模型
节点。
重要提示:
如果
FTOptixApplication
停止执行,则会删除编辑模型
节点及其数据。提供反馈